edward wrote: hi, if someone has irritable bowel syndrome does this qualify for the support group? also does anyone know how long someone has to wait for an appeal hearing?
thanks


ESA awards are made on the limitations that result from a condition. not the condition itself, so no! IBS in itself will not result in an award of ESA at either level.

Have a look at our ESA Claim guides for a better understanding of how the ESA Descriptors work.

www.benefitsandwork.co.uk/help-for-claimants/esa

Appeal times do vary across the country, but as a rule of thumb, probably six months from when the DWP Reconsideration is completed.

The only descriptor I can think of for the Support Group that might relate to IBS is;

Absence or loss of control whilst conscious leading to extensive evacuation
of the bowel and/or bladder, other than enuresis (bed-wetting), despite the
wearing or use of any aids or adaptations which are normally, or could
reasonably be, worn or used.
At least once a week experiences
(i) loss of control leading to extensive evacuation of the bowel and/or voiding of the
bladder; or
(ii) substantial leakage of the contents of a collecting device;
sufficient to require cleaning and a change in clothing.
